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54291 7364 4429036352
980271 2040297 78743
980271 2040297 78743
6876 78921881 43591
All about undefined
Interested in learning more?
980271 2040297 78743
6876 78921881 43591
See more
358326 5551538048
05 313358223 3285506678
See more
972 27628893
23799806882 14753173 944462716
See more